Skip to main content
This email address is being protected from spambots. You need JavaScript enabled to view it. | +1 305 517 7570 | Mon-Fri 10:00-17:00 EST

How to Open Bank Account for Seychelles Company

How to Open Bank Account for Seychelles Company
Last updated on February 04 2025. Written by Offshore Protection.

Opening a bank account for a Seychelles company is a crucial step in establishing an offshore business presence. The process involves gathering necessary documents, choosing the right bank, and navigating anti-money laundering regulations. Seychelles offers a relatively swift company formation process, making it an attractive jurisdiction for offshore banking.

Banks in Seychelles typically require proof of identity, proof of address, and company incorporation documents for corporate accounts. A minimum deposit of $10,000 is often necessary to open an account, with maintenance fees around $15 per month. The Seychelles International Business Company (IBC) structure is popular among offshore entities seeking banking services in the jurisdiction.

Key Takeaways

  • Seychelles offers efficient company formation and offshore banking options
  • Banks require specific documentation and minimum deposits for corporate accounts
  • Understanding anti-money laundering regulations is essential for successful account opening

Understanding Offshore Banking in Seychelles

Seychelles has emerged as a prominent offshore banking destination, offering financial privacy, asset protection, and potential tax advantages. The country's banking system caters to international clients seeking secure and confidential financial services.

Offshore banking in Seychelles operates on the principles of confidentiality and asset protection. Banks in the country adhere to strict privacy laws, safeguarding client information from unauthorized access. The Central Bank of Seychelles regulates financial institutions, ensuring compliance with international standards.

Seychelles banks offer a range of services tailored for offshore clients, including multi-currency accounts, online banking, and wealth management solutions. These institutions typically require minimal documentation for account opening, streamlining the process for foreign investors.

Benefits of a Seychelles Bank Account

Opening a bank account in Seychelles provides several advantages for international businesses and individuals. The country's stable political environment and robust financial sector contribute to its appeal as an offshore banking hub.

Key benefits include:

  • Financial privacy and confidentiality
  • Asset protection from potential legal claims
  • Multi-currency transactions
  • Potential tax optimization opportunities
  • Access to international banking services

Seychelles banks often offer competitive interest rates and lower fees compared to onshore institutions, making them attractive for wealth preservation and growth.

Seychelles as an Offshore Financial Center

Seychelles has established itself as a reputable offshore financial center, attracting clients from around the world. The country's legal framework supports international business activities while maintaining compliance with global financial standards.

The Seychelles International Business Authority (SIBA) oversees the offshore sector, ensuring transparency and adherence to anti-money laundering regulations. This regulatory environment has helped Seychelles maintain its status as a trusted jurisdiction for offshore banking.

Foreign investors can benefit from the country's double taxation agreements with several nations, potentially reducing their tax liabilities. Seychelles' strategic location and modern banking infrastructure further enhance its appeal as an offshore financial hub.

Setting up an International Business Company (IBC) in Seychelles

Establishing an International Business Company in Seychelles offers a streamlined process, tax benefits, and flexible corporate structures. This offshore jurisdiction attracts entrepreneurs and investors seeking efficient business solutions.

Company Formation Process

Forming an IBC in Seychelles is quick and straightforward. The process typically takes 24-48 hours. To begin, choose a unique company name and submit the required documents to a registered agent.

Key steps include:

  1. Name reservation
  2. Preparation of memorandum and articles of association
  3. Appointment of directors and shareholders
  4. Payment of registration fees

A minimum of one director and one shareholder is required. These can be individuals or corporate entities. No residency requirements apply for directors or shareholders.

Advantages of IBCs

Seychelles IBCs offer numerous benefits to international businesses:

  • Tax exemption on foreign-sourced income
  • No minimum capital requirements
  • Confidentiality of shareholder information
  • Flexible corporate structure
  • No annual reporting obligations

IBCs can conduct various business activities outside Seychelles, including trading, investment holding, and consultancy services. The jurisdiction's stable political environment and modern legal framework further enhance its appeal.

Legal and Compliance Requirements

While Seychelles IBCs enjoy many freedoms, they must adhere to certain legal and compliance standards:

  • Maintain a registered office in Seychelles
  • Appoint a local registered agent
  • Keep financial records for 7 years
  • Comply with anti-money laundering regulations

IBCs are prohibited from conducting business within Seychelles or owning real estate in the country. They must also avoid regulated activities such as banking or insurance without proper licenses.

To ensure ongoing compliance, companies should work closely with their registered agent and seek professional advice when necessary.

Choosing the Right Bank in Seychelles

Comparative Overview of Banks in Seychelles

Seychelles hosts several banks catering to international businesses. Absa Bank (Seychelles) Limited requires a minimum account balance of US$35,000 and offers remote account opening with full online banking facilities.

Other banks in Seychelles include:

  • Bank of Baroda
  • Mauritius Commercial Bank (Seychelles)
  • Seychelles Commercial Bank
  • Nouvobanq

Each bank has unique requirements and services. Some focus on personal banking, while others specialize in corporate accounts. Prospective clients should compare fees, minimum balance requirements, and available currencies.

Seychelles Commercial Bank and Nouvobanq

Seychelles Commercial Bank and Nouvobanq are two prominent local banks. Seychelles Commercial Bank offers a range of corporate banking services, including multi-currency accounts and trade finance solutions.

Nouvobanq provides comprehensive business banking services, such as:

  • Corporate savings accounts
  • Fixed deposit accounts
  • International transfers
  • Online banking platforms

Both banks have expertise in serving Seychelles International Business Companies (IBCs) and understand the unique needs of offshore businesses.

Considerations for Corporate Accounts

When opening a corporate account, businesses should evaluate several factors:

  1. Multi-currency capabilities
  2. International transfer fees
  3. Online banking features
  4. Trade finance services
  5. Relationship manager support

Banks may require proof of company registration, director identification, and source of funds documentation. Some institutions offer dedicated corporate relationship managers to assist with complex banking needs.

Corporate accounts often come with higher minimum balance requirements and transaction limits compared to personal accounts. Businesses should assess their anticipated transaction volumes and cash flow needs when selecting a bank.

Requirements for Opening a Bank Account for Seychelles Company

Opening a bank account for a Seychelles company involves several key requirements. Banks conduct thorough checks to ensure compliance with regulations and mitigate risks.

Necessary Documentation

Proof of identity is essential for all company directors and shareholders. This typically includes a valid passport or government-issued ID. Proof of address is also required, often in the form of a recent utility bill or bank statement dated within the last three months.

Company documents play a crucial role. These include the Certificate of Incorporation, Articles of Association, and a Certificate of Incumbency. The latter verifies the current directors and shareholders of the company.

A detailed business plan may be requested, outlining the company's activities, projected income, and source of funds. This helps the bank understand the nature and legitimacy of the business.

Due Diligence Checks and KYC

Banks in Seychelles adhere to strict Know Your Customer (KYC) procedures. This involves verifying the identity of all individuals associated with the company. Background checks are conducted to assess potential risks.

The source of funds must be clearly demonstrated. Banks may request additional documentation such as contracts, invoices, or financial statements to support this.

Some banks may require a minimum deposit to open an account. This can range from $10,000 to $35,000, depending on the institution.

A letter of recommendation from another bank or a professional advisor can strengthen the application. This provides additional assurance of the company's credibility.

   

 
 
Go Global with Confidence & Learn How to Incorporate Overseas to Fortify Your Business.
 
 
 

  

Understanding the Account Opening Process

The account opening process typically begins with an initial application. This can often be done remotely, though some banks may require in-person meetings.

Banks review all submitted documents carefully. They may request additional information or clarification if needed. This review process can take several weeks.

A board resolution authorizing the opening of the account is usually required. This document specifies who has authority to operate the account on behalf of the company.

Some banks offer online banking facilities, allowing for easy management of the account once opened. Fees for account maintenance and transactions vary between institutions.

Anti-Money Laundering Regulations

Seychelles imposes strict anti-money laundering (AML) regulations on its banking sector. These measures aim to prevent financial crimes and ensure the integrity of the country's financial system. Banks in Seychelles must adhere to comprehensive AML policies and conduct thorough due diligence on account holders.

AML Policies in Seychelles

The Central Bank of Seychelles oversees AML regulations in the country. Financial institutions are required to implement robust AML programs that include customer identification procedures, transaction monitoring, and suspicious activity reporting. Banks must verify the identity of their clients and understand the nature of their business activities.

Key elements of Seychelles' AML policies include:

    • Certificate of Incorporation
    • Memorandum and Articles of Association
    • Register of Directors and Shareholders
    • Proof of registered office address
    • Passport copies of directors and beneficial owners
    • Proof of address for directors and beneficial owners
    • Business plan or company profile

These measures align with international standards set by organizations like the Financial Action Task Force (FATF).

Ensuring Compliance

Banks in Seychelles must appoint compliance officers to oversee their AML programs. These officers are responsible for implementing and maintaining AML policies, training staff, and ensuring adherence to regulatory requirements.

Compliance measures include:

  • Regular staff training on AML procedures
  • Internal audits and risk assessments
  • Updating AML policies to reflect changes in regulations
  • Cooperation with regulatory authorities

Banks face significant penalties for non-compliance, including fines and potential loss of their banking license. The Central Bank of Seychelles conducts regular inspections to assess compliance with AML regulations.

Impact on Account Opening

AML regulations significantly affect the account opening process for Seychelles companies. Banks are required to conduct thorough due diligence on potential clients, which can make the process more time-consuming and documentation-intensive.

Required documents typically include:

  • Proof of identity for all company directors and beneficial owners
  • Company incorporation documents
  • Business plan and projected financials
  • Source of funds and source of wealth declarations

Banks may request additional information to satisfy their AML requirements. This process can take several weeks or even months, depending on the complexity of the company structure and the completeness of the provided documentation.

Anti-Money Laundering Policies

Seychelles has stringent anti-money laundering (AML) policies in place. Banks require comprehensive due diligence on account holders and their transactions. Companies must provide detailed information about their business activities, source of funds, and beneficial owners.

Enhanced customer due diligence is often applied to high-risk sectors or transactions. Ongoing monitoring of account activity is standard practice to detect suspicious patterns.

Banks may request additional documentation or clarification on certain transactions. Failure to comply with AML policies can result in account closure or regulatory penalties.

Central Bank of Seychelles Regulations

The Central Bank of Seychelles (CBS) oversees the banking sector and sets regulatory standards. It mandates minimum capital requirements for banks and enforces prudential norms.

CBS regulations require banks to maintain accurate records of all transactions. They must report large or suspicious transactions to the Financial Intelligence Unit.

The central bank conducts regular audits and inspections of financial institutions. It also issues guidelines on risk management and corporate governance for banks.

Financial Services Authority Guidelines

The Financial Services Authority (FSA) of Seychelles regulates non-bank financial services. It provides guidelines for offshore companies seeking to open bank accounts.

FSA requires companies to maintain proper books and records. Annual audited financial statements may be necessary for certain types of entities.

The authority emphasizes transparency in ownership structures. Companies must disclose ultimate beneficial owners and any changes in shareholding.

FSA guidelines outline requirements for director residency and local representation. Compliance with these guidelines is crucial for maintaining good standing with banks and regulators.

Frequently Asked Questions

What are the requirements to open a bank account for a Seychelles company?

Banks in Seychelles typically require proof of company registration, identification documents for directors and shareholders, and a clear explanation of the company's business activities. A minimum deposit amount may also be necessary.

Compliance with anti-money laundering regulations is crucial. Banks conduct due diligence checks to verify the legitimacy of funds and business operations.

What documents are needed for Seychelles company formation with an accompanying bank account?

Essential documents include the certificate of incorporation, memorandum and articles of association, and register of directors and shareholders. Proof of address for the company and its key individuals is also required.

Banks may request additional documentation such as business plans, financial projections, and source of funds declarations.

Are there specific banks in Seychelles that are recommended for opening a company bank account?

Several banks in Seychelles offer corporate account services. Popular choices include Seychelles Commercial Bank, Nouvobanq, and Bank of Baroda.

Each bank has its own strengths and specialties. Research is essential to find the best fit for specific business needs and transaction volumes.

How does one open a company bank account remotely for a Seychelles-based business?

Some Seychelles banks offer remote account opening services. This process typically involves submitting notarized documents electronically and conducting video interviews for verification purposes.

A local representative or registered agent may be required to facilitate the process and liaise with the bank on behalf of the company.

What is the typical timeline for opening a corporate bank account in Seychelles?

The account opening process can take anywhere from a few weeks to several months. Factors affecting the timeline include the completeness of submitted documents and the bank's due diligence procedures.

Prompt responses to any additional information requests can help expedite the process.

What are the fees associated with establishing a bank account for a new company in Seychelles?

Banks in Seychelles generally charge account opening fees, monthly maintenance fees, and transaction fees. These costs vary between institutions and account types.

Some banks may require a minimum balance to waive certain fees. It's advisable to compare fee structures across different banks before making a decision.

Secure Your Business & Assets.

Risk nothing with our tailored strategies designed specifically for you.
Schedule your confidential consultation today.

Please Be Aware: Under the Foreign Account Tax Compliance Act(FATCA) and the Common Reporting Standard (CRS), you cannot eliminate your taxes without changing your residence if you live in a country subject to these regulations. While an offshore company can enhance your privacy and protect your assets, you remain responsible for fulfilling tax obligations in your country of residence, including any taxes tied to the ownership of overseas entities.

Non-resident companies are not taxed in the country where they are incorporated. However, as the owner, you are required to pay taxes in your country of residence. Offshore Protection is not a tax advisor. Please consult a qualified local tax or legal professional for personalized advice.

Go Deeper

Offshore Diversification Strategies
Offshore Online

Offshore Company Guides
Offshore Tax Havens
Offshore Cryptocurrency
Offshore Wealth Security

Asset Protection & Financial Survival Strategies to Secure your Future

How To Protect Yourself, Your Assets And Your Freedom

  Why You Need A Plan B
  Threats to Your Assets
  Global Diversification Planning